Formula
Hourly Rate = (Salary + SE Tax + Benefits + Overhead) / (1 - Profit Margin) / Annual Billable Hours
Frequently Asked Questions
Why should my consulting rate be higher than my hourly salary?
As a consultant, you pay self-employment taxes (15.3%), fund your own benefits (health insurance, retirement, PTO), cover business overhead, and have non-billable hours. A good rule of thumb is to charge 2-3x your equivalent hourly salary rate.
What is a typical consulting rate?
Rates vary widely by industry and expertise. Management consultants charge $150-$400/hr, IT consultants $100-$250/hr, and marketing consultants $100-$300/hr. Specialized expertise commands premium rates.
How many hours should I expect to bill?
Most independent consultants bill 25-35 hours per week. The remaining time goes to business development, administration, marketing, and professional development. Plan for about 60-70% utilization rate.
